Output e3d56c3d8a7f4ef38b6c1e7217051f54cb858b04b07122950509445adb87d7d6:3

value
23756960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b16671f64fd683630f02e8ce530b129324a5ea57 OP_EQUALVERIFY OP_CHECKSIG
address
1HB1KyC612Q9WfiKgJTWZMH6FxcYD3sbkP
transaction
e3d56c3d8a7f4ef38b6c1e7217051f54cb858b04b07122950509445adb87d7d6
spent
true